I’d put your finger right into those fluid spots to see what’s there.

The steering is electric, and the diff is on the other end of the car, so I’d imagine it’s oil, coolant, transmission fluid (transmission is supposed to be maintenance free and maybe sealed, but if it has fluid & seals it could leak), windshield wiper fluid or possibly fuel.

(On the unlikely chance that you have a fuel leak, I wouldn’t drive it until it’s been found and fixed - you don’t want it igniting on a hot header or other potential ignition source)

And I haven’t really gotten under the car, but IIRC there’s a panel on the underside of the front end & engine for aero, so things may be leaking out out in one place and appearing in another after dripping onto the panel and then dripping down to the ground somewhere else.

Speed Warning Principle
The speed warning can be used to set a speed
limit. A warning will be issued when this speed
limit is exceeded.

General information
The warning is repeated if the vehicle speed exceeds
the set speed limit again, after it has dropped
below it by 3 mph/5 km/h.

Adjusting
1. "CAR"
2. "Settings"
3. "General settings"
4. "Speed warning"
5. "Warning at:"
6. Turn the Controller until the desired speed is displayed.
7. Press the Controller.

Activate/deactivate
1. "CAR"
2. "Settings"
3. "General settings"
4. "Speed warning"
5. "Speed warning"
